Perforation

Perforations are the decorative and fucntional pattern of holes punched into the trim of a shoe. Perforations can come in a variety of designs and are found on a variety of men's dressy-styled shoes such as loafers, oxfords and balmorals as well as athletic and casual shoes. Perforations are not meant to stand out exclusively from the shoe, so they are always the same color of the shoe's leather. The perforations can be found on the toe area, the heel and sides of the shoe's upper. In addition to style, perforations also allow for increased breathability, which is very important for odor and bacteria control.
